§ Government Contracting Lexicon

Set-Aside.

A set-aside is a contract reserved for competition among a specific category of small businesses, such as small business, 8(a), HUBZone, WOSB, or SDVOSB, so large firms cannot compete for it.

In practice, for a bidder.

Set-asides are how the government meets its small-business goals. Whether a requirement is set aside is often decided from the market research (Sources Sought) responses, which is why responding to those matters.
